About this website:

The website token.gpu.net appears to be related to cryptocurrency and airdrops, which are often associated with scams and fraudulent activities in the crypto space. Here are some reasons why this website might be considered suspicious: 1. Lack of Clear Information: The website lacks clear and detailed information about the project, its team, and its goals. Legitimate cryptocurrency projects typically provide transparent information about these aspects. 2. Unrealistic Promises: The website may make unrealistic promises about earning cryptocurrency through airdrops or other means. Be cautious of any platform that guarantees high returns with little effort. 3. Social Media Engagement: The website encourages users to engage with its social media accounts for rewards. While this can be a legitimate marketing tactic, it's also commonly used in scams to increase visibility and credibility. 4. Connect Wallet Prompt: The prompt to connect a wallet without clear information on why it's necessary can be a red flag. Users should be cautious about sharing their wallet information on unfamiliar platforms. 5. Vague Use of Blockchain Terminology: The website uses terms like "on-chain reputation" and "GXP" without clear explanations of how these concepts are implemented. This can be a tactic to appear legitimate without providing meaningful details. 6.
